Welcome to Marathon Airport. This small airport is located just northeast of Marathon, Ontario, Canada. It sits about 2.6 nautical miles from the town. Marathon Airport has the IATA code YSP and the ICAO code CYSP. It serves as a key point for travelers looking to explore the beautiful landscapes of Northern Ontario. Marathon Airport, with the IATA code YSP, is located just 2.6 nautical miles northeast of Marathon, Ontario, Canada. This airport serves as a key point for travelers in the region. It offers both land and water access, making it versatile for different types of flights. The airport is part of the National Airports System, ensuring it meets high standards for safety and service.
